An AI Governance Committee provides oversight, sets standards, and ensures responsible AI deployment. Here's how to build one that's effective, not just ceremonial.
Why You Need a Committee
AI decisions span technology, business, legal, and ethics. No single person has all necessary expertise. A committee:
- Brings diverse perspectives to AI decisions
- Ensures cross-functional alignment
- Provides checks and balances
- Demonstrates governance to stakeholders
- Shares responsibility for AI outcomes
Committee Structure
Core Members
- Chairperson (C-level executive)
Sets agenda, drives decisions, reports to board
- Chief Technology Officer
Technical feasibility and architecture oversight
- General Counsel / Chief Legal Officer
Legal compliance and liability management
- Chief Risk Officer
Risk identification and mitigation strategies
- Chief Information Security Officer
Security controls and threat management
- Chief Privacy Officer / Data Protection Officer
Privacy compliance and data governance
Extended Members
- Business unit leaders: Represent agent use cases
- AI/ML experts: Technical deep dives
- Ethics advisor: Ethical implications
- Compliance officer: Regulatory requirements
- HR representative: Workforce impact

Committee Responsibilities
Strategic
- Define AI governance vision and principles
- Set priorities for AI investments
- Approve high-risk agent deployments
- Review and update governance policies
Operational
- Review agent deployment requests
- Investigate governance incidents
- Monitor compliance metrics
- Provide guidance on complex cases
Oversight
- Audit agent systems and controls
- Assess emerging risks
- Ensure policy adherence
- Report to board of directors
Meeting Cadence and Agenda
Monthly Meetings
Typical Agenda:
- Review previous action items (10 min)
- Agent deployment approvals (20 min)
- Incident reviews (15 min)
- Metrics and dashboard review (15 min)
- Policy updates or new topics (20 min)
- Regulatory updates (10 min)
Quarterly Reviews
- Comprehensive governance effectiveness assessment
- Agent portfolio review
- Risk landscape changes
- Budget and resource planning
Annual Strategy
- Set governance priorities for the year
- Review maturity and progress
- Update governance framework
- Present to board of directors
Decision-Making Process
Agent Approval Workflow
- Submission: Agent owner submits proposal with risk assessment
- Initial review: Governance team checks completeness
- Risk assessment: Classify agent risk level
- Committee review: Discussion and evaluation
- Decision: Approve, conditional approval, or reject
- Documentation: Record decision and rationale
Decision Criteria
- Business value and strategic alignment
- Risk level and mitigation adequacy
- Compliance with policies and regulations
- Technical readiness and quality
- Ethical considerations
Making the Committee Effective
Clear Charter
Document committee purpose, scope, and authority:
- Mission and objectives
- Decision-making authority
- Membership and terms
- Meeting frequency and procedures
- Reporting relationships
Efficient Operations
- Pre-read materials: Distribute documents in advance
- Time management: Stick to agenda and schedule
- Action tracking: Clear ownership and deadlines
- Meeting minutes: Document decisions and rationale
Continuous Improvement
- Annual self-assessment of committee effectiveness
- Solicit feedback from stakeholders
- Benchmark against industry practices
- Adapt processes based on learnings
Success Metrics
Measure committee impact:
- Decision quality: Outcomes of approved agents
- Decision speed: Time from submission to approval
- Incident prevention: Issues caught before deployment
- Stakeholder satisfaction: Feedback from agent owners
- Compliance record: Violations prevented
A well-run governance committee accelerates responsible AI adoption. It's not about saying "no"—it's about enabling teams to deploy agents safely and with confidence.
The dysfunction patterns afflicting governance committees mirror those of any cross-functional group but intensify with AI's technical complexity and rapid evolution. Meetings degenerate into status updates rather than strategic discussions. Technical members dominate conversations while business stakeholders disengage. Decisions drag across multiple sessions as members seek perfect information before committing. The committee becomes a bottleneck where agent deployments queue for approval, frustrating teams and creating incentives to circumvent governance entirely. Effective committees combat these patterns through disciplined facilitation: timed agendas with pre-allocated slots, decision frameworks that guide discussion toward resolution rather than endless debate, delegated authority where lower-risk decisions bypass full committee review, and transparent communication of decision rationale that builds organizational trust in governance outcomes.
The committee's effectiveness depends on maintaining current knowledge of rapidly evolving AI capabilities and risks—a challenge when members juggle governance alongside demanding primary roles. Leading organizations invest in governance team education: monthly AI briefings covering technology developments, quarterly deep-dives into emerging risks, external expert presentations providing outside perspectives, and participation in industry governance groups that share practices and learnings. This continuous learning prevents the governance lag where committees apply outdated mental models to current technology, leading to either excessive caution (blocking viable agents based on obsolete risk assessments) or dangerous permissiveness (approving agents without recognizing novel threats that recent research revealed). The governance committee that learns as quickly as AI evolves provides oversight that remains relevant rather than becoming either obstructive or obsolete.
